Flow model of geothermal fluid in Reshuizhen geothermal field of Chifeng
SHI Zhuo, JIN Xu, GUAN Yan-Wu, CHEN Xiao-Dong
College of Geoexploration Science and Technology��Jilin University��Changchun 130026��China
Abstract:

There are NS��NW--SE��NE --SW and WE direction faults developed in Reshuizhen geothermal field��and most of them are tensional faults forming the main channels for hot water growing up�� The recharge area of the hot water is the western and northern mountainous areas away from the geothermal field to west and north where the precipitation permeated into the ground and flowed to the lower part of the geothermal field�� The water was heated by invaded granite and basalt rocks by means of heat conduction��and then went along with the fractures�� forming a shallow water reservoir of geothermal field�� The geothermal field water belongs to mid-low temperature fracture water originated from precipitation��

Keywords: Chifeng   geothermal field   heat source   hot water origin   geothermal fluid
